For many modern vehicles, particularly those with sealed bearing units or tightly integrated hub assemblies, the traditional hammer-and-chisel method is simply not viable. Attempting to force a bearing out or in without the proper equipment almost guarantees damage to either the bearing itself or the surrounding components, like the spindle or steering knuckle. This is where a dedicated front wheel bearing press kit truly shines.

Understanding the function of a wheel bearing is fundamental. It allows your wheels to rotate freely while supporting the vehicle's weight and handling lateral forces during turns. When this component fails, it can lead to noise, vibration, and, in severe cases, a complete wheel separation. Core Mechanics of a Press Kit

At its heart, a front wheel bearing press kit utilizes a C-frame or H-frame press mechanism combined with a series of precisely machined cups and adapters. The press provides the motive force, pushing or pulling components, while the cups and adapters distribute this force evenly across the bearing race or hub. This controlled application of pressure is what differentiates it from brute-force methods.

This mechanism is critical for preventing damage to the bearing's delicate internal components and the housing it sits within. Such precision is paramount for longevity.

Best Practices for Operation

Always consult the vehicle's service manual for specific bearing torque and press-in depth specifications. Before pressing, inspect the spindle and hub bore for any debris, rust, or burrs that could impede installation or damage the new bearing. Use the correct size adapter to apply pressure only to the outer bearing race or the hub flange, never to the bearing cage or internal components.
